      The increased risk of genetic defects in close blooded marriages is due to the fact that when two closely related individuals have children, there is a higher likelihood that they will carry the same genetic mutations. These mutations may have been present in their common ancestor, and since they are related, they may have inherited the same mutated genes.
      However, it's important to note that not all children born from close blooded marriages will have genetic defects. In fact, most will not. It's just that the risk is higher compared to children born from unrelated parents.

      People with serious mental disorders have occasionally come to Vipassana courses with the unrealistic expectation that the technique will cure or alleviate their mental problems. Unstable interpersonal relationships and a history of various treatments can be additional factors which make it difficult for such people to benefit from, or even complete, a ten-day course. Our capacity as a nonprofessional volunteer organization makes it impossible for us to properly care for people with these backgrounds. Although Vipassana meditation is beneficial for most people, it is not a substitute for medical or psychiatric treatment and we do not recommend it for people with serious psychiatric disorders.
